At Four Seasons Hotel Firenze, nestled in the heart of Florence and set within two majestic Renaissance palaces surrounded by the historic Giardino della Gherardesca, our reputation for refined hospitality, artistic richness, and employee care has been built over many years. As we continue to elevate guest experience and operations alike, we seek an exceptional Director of People & Culture to lead our People & Culture and Learning agenda and reinforce our status as a benchmark employer in the region.
You will report directly to the General Manager, with a dotted line to the Regional Director of People & Culture, EMEA.
You will drive strategies that enrich our team culture, attract and retain top talent, and ensure that our workplace is one where every colleague thrives. You will act as both a strategic partner to operations and a champion for employee engagement, learning & development, and wellbeing, ensuring that Firenze remains not only a destination of choice for guests, but also for people building a hospitality career.
Key Responsibilities
- Serve as the Cultural Advocate of the Golden Rule: uphold Four Seasons’ values in all programs and employee interactions.
- Strategise and oversee talent management: recruitment, selection, onboarding, retention, and succession planning to ensure a strong pipeline of internal talent.
- Partner with department heads to support operational decisions, forecast people needs, align HR strategy with business goals, and enable performance excellence.
- Lead compensation and benefits strategy benchmarking against both local Italian/hospitality standards and Four Seasons global expectations; balance cost, fairness, and the employee experience.
- Develop and maintain learning & development programmes: from onboarding to leadership development, skills training, performance improvement, with metrics to evaluate effectiveness.
- Monitor and influence the employee experience: engagement, satisfaction, reward & recognition, wellbeing, employee relations, and compliance with Italian labour law and Four Seasons standards.
- Drive corporate People & Culture initiatives locally – diversity, inclusion, wellbeing, community engagement – ensuring alignment with hotel and regional goals.
Our Ideal Director of People and Culture candidate will have :
- Deep passion for people, culture, and learning; you are a trusted business partner with strong strategic thinking and operational sensibility.
- Extensive experience in luxury hospitality or related sectors, ideally with multi‐disciplinary exposure (HR, talent, learning).
- Excellent leadership and communication skills; ability to influence at all levels.
- Fluency in Italian and English; fluency in additional languages is a plus.
- Legal eligibility to work in Italy.

Four Seasons Hotels and Resorts opened its first hotel in 1961, and since that time has been dedicated to perfecting the travel experience through continual innovation and the highest standards of hospitality. Currently operating more than 120 hotels and resorts, and more than 50 residential properties in major city centers and resort destinations in 47 countries, and with more than 50 projects under planning or development, Four Seasons consistently ranks among the world's best hotels and most prestigious brands in reader polls, traveler reviews and industry awards.
